Faculty Emotional Intelligence Matters for Resident Education
Holly B Weis1, Maryanne L Pickett1, Joshua J Weis1
1Department of Surgery, University of Texas Southwestern, Dallas, Texas.
Surgical faculty emotional intelligence (EI) positively correlates with resident evaluations of teaching behaviors. Higher EI among faculty enhances the clinical learning environment and overall resident education.
Area of Science:
- Medical Education
- Surgical Training
- Psychology in Medicine
Background:
- Emotional intelligence (EI) is crucial for effective clinical teaching and mentorship.
- Assessing EI in surgical faculty can identify areas for professional development.
- Understanding the link between faculty EI and resident feedback is vital for improving surgical education.
Purpose of the Study:
- To determine the emotional intelligence levels of surgical faculty.
- To evaluate the relationship between faculty EI and resident evaluations of faculty behaviors.
Main Methods:
- Retrospective collection of faculty EI scores and resident evaluations.
- Administration of the 28-item Emotional Intelligence Appraisal to surgical faculty.
- Statistical analysis using parametric and nonparametric tests.
Main Results:
- A moderate, positive correlation was found between faculty EI scores and resident rotational evaluations (r=0.52, p < 0.001).
- Faculty EI scores did not significantly correlate with resident evaluations of intraoperative behaviors.
- The mean EI score for participating faculty was 76 ± 7.7.
Conclusions:
- Surgical faculty generally demonstrate competent levels of emotional intelligence.
- Faculty EI is a significant factor influencing the clinical learning environment.
- Faculty EI correlates with resident evaluations of teaching effectiveness.
